When Should My Kid Have Their First Oral Visit?



For most children, it's recommended to arrange their initial dental browse through by the age of one to ensure proper oral health care from an early age. This early check out enables the pediatric dentist to check the growth of your kid's teeth, give guidance on appropriate dental health practices, and detect any prospective issues beforehand. It also aids your child come to be familiar with the dental office atmosphere, lowering anxiety throughout future gos to.



Throughout the first oral see, the dental practitioner will examine your kid's mouth, gums, and any type of arising teeth. What Prevail Pediatric Dental Procedures?



Common pediatric oral procedures usually consist of regular cleansings, oral fillings, and fluoride treatments. Routine cleanings are important for preserving your youngster's oral wellness by eliminating plaque and tartar accumulation that can lead to tooth cavities and periodontal illness. These cleansings are usually executed by a dental hygienist who'll also give important pointers on appropriate oral health techniques for your child.

Fluoride therapies are one more typical procedure in pediatric dentistry. Fluoride aids to enhance the enamel of the teeth, making them extra resistant to decay. These treatments are commonly advised by dental experts to help protect against tooth cavities and maintain excellent oral health and wellness.

Various other typical pediatric oral procedures may consist of dental sealers, removals, and orthodontic analyses. These procedures aim to ensure your child's teeth are healthy and balanced and effectively straightened as they expand.

How Can I Assist My Youngster With Oral Hygiene in the house?



To aid preserve your youngster's oral wellness in between oral check outs, guaranteeing proper dental health in the house is vital. Beginning by teaching your kid the importance of cleaning their teeth at the very least twice a day with fluoride toothpaste. Manage them while brushing to make sure they're using the right method and reaching all locations of their mouth. Urge them to spit out the toothpaste rather than swallowing it.

In addition to cleaning, make flossing an everyday practice for your youngster, specifically when their teeth begin to touch. Flossing helps remove food particles and plaque from between the teeth where a toothbrush can't reach. Take into consideration using enjoyable flavored floss or floss picks to make the procedure more satisfying for your kid.
